Transaction 95aaa98e958195f9959016102dfe1d6a0847a7d8c5d1fe0df391f136e92935a8

block
bb1c337af014c41b1484e7e7863c89caffb154d8449e5e157dc6d538b12c98ee

1 Input

414 Outputs